Silchar, Sept. 16 -- The Directorate of Revenue Intelligence (DRI), in a joint operation with the Assam Rifles seized 109.2 kilograms of banned narcotic substance Yaba tablets worth an estimated Rs.327 crore in Assam's Hailakandi district, near Mizoram border, and arrested one person, officials said on Wednesday.

The Assam Rifles on Wednesday said this was one of the largest-ever recoveries of drugs in Assam till date.

As per the official statement, based on specific intelligence, a joint team of the Assam Rifles and DRI conducted an operation in the Ramnathpur area of Hailakandi, on the intervening night of September 15 and 16.
